Output e6934ec3216c9dbee68e0a28b81fd43f3c3062689c2a9f5a135d11257e4f7a2a:10

value
610472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 949dca62a598284f1db3465673c85476950634ed OP_EQUAL
address
3FEpxR41bbeyiUeDXj7nE3RwWcxUfHhu6F
transaction
e6934ec3216c9dbee68e0a28b81fd43f3c3062689c2a9f5a135d11257e4f7a2a